The decedent account bank for taxes in Maryland is an essential tool for administrators managing the assets of a decedent's estate. This model letter template requests the necessary bank account information from financial institutions, aiding the administrator in determining the estate's assets and liabilities. Key features include a structured format for gathering account statements, certificates of deposit, and details about any safe deposit boxes held by the decedent. Instructions for filling out the letter involve adapting it to fit specific facts, including the decedent's name and account information. The form also prompts the bank to provide additional details such as account opening and closing dates, enhancing the administrator's knowledge for tax purposes. Complete the federal estate tax return, Form 706, for the year of the decedent's death, regardless of whether Form 706 is required to be filed with the Internal Revenue Service. Include the federal return, complete with all schedules, attachments and supporting documents when filing the Maryland estate tax return.
